sql implode能用于不同類型嗎

sql
小樊
81
2024-10-19 15:02:58
欄目: 云計(jì)算

在 SQL 中,implode 函數(shù)通常用于將數(shù)組或類似數(shù)組的結(jié)構(gòu)中的元素連接成一個(gè)字符串。然而,并非所有數(shù)據(jù)庫(kù)系統(tǒng)都支持 implode 函數(shù),且其具體實(shí)現(xiàn)和可用性可能因數(shù)據(jù)庫(kù)系統(tǒng)而異。

對(duì)于支持 implode 函數(shù)的數(shù)據(jù)庫(kù)系統(tǒng)(如 MySQL),該函數(shù)通常只能用于字符串類型的數(shù)組。如果你嘗試將非字符串類型的元素放入 implode 函數(shù)的參數(shù)中,數(shù)據(jù)庫(kù)系統(tǒng)可能會(huì)拋出錯(cuò)誤或返回意外的結(jié)果。

如果你需要將不同類型的數(shù)據(jù)連接成一個(gè)字符串,你可能需要使用其他方法,例如使用數(shù)據(jù)庫(kù)特定的字符串連接函數(shù)(如 MySQL 的 CONCAT 函數(shù))或編寫自定義的 SQL 查詢來(lái)實(shí)現(xiàn)。

請(qǐng)注意,具體的 SQL 語(yǔ)法和函數(shù)可能因數(shù)據(jù)庫(kù)系統(tǒng)而異,因此建議查閱你所使用的數(shù)據(jù)庫(kù)系統(tǒng)的文檔以了解可用的字符串連接和數(shù)組操作函數(shù)。

0